Whether you are a seasoned wrench-turner or simply want to talk intelligently with your technician, having the right information helps you make a confident, cost-effective decision about your vehicle&#8217;s engine computer.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"info-section\">\n<h2>What the PCM Does in a 2000 Toyota Tundra<\/h2>\n<p>The engine control module in your 2000 Toyota Tundra functions as the central processor for the truck&#8217;s fuel and ignition systems. It continuously reads input from sensors monitoring throttle position, coolant temperature, oxygen content, and crankshaft rotation, then adjusts injector pulse width and spark timing to maintain efficient combustion. Because the 3.4L V6 relies on this unit for both engine management and transmission control, a failing module can affect drivability across the board. You may notice hesitation during acceleration, erratic idle behavior, or even a complete no-start condition. Understanding the module&#8217;s role helps you appreciate why proper programming matters before the truck returns to service.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"info-section\">\n<h2>Where the PCM Is Located and What Replacement Involves<\/h2>\n<p>According to the factory wiring guide&#8217;s component grid, the engine ECU in your 2000 Toyota Tundra is located within the instrument panel area. Accessing it typically involves working around the dashboard region to reach the module and its connectors. The published labor time for removing and replacing either the engine control module or the powertrain control module is 0.5 hours. A relearn procedure, which may be required after installation, carries an additional 0.5 hours of book time. Because the module sits behind interior trim, care should be taken with connector removal to avoid damaging the wiring harness or locking tabs. The ECU connectors often have retention levers that must be fully released before pulling them free. Once the replacement module is seated, the same 0.5-hour removal and replacement time applies for reassembly. This eliminates the additional labor time and gets your Tundra back on the road faster.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"info-section\">\n<h2>Symptoms of a Failing PCM<\/h2>\n<p>A failing engine control module in your 2000 Toyota Tundra can produce a range of drivability symptoms that often mimic other problems, making diagnosis tricky. Common signs include a no-start condition where the engine cranks but never fires, intermittent stalling while idling or driving, and persistent misfire codes that do not resolve after replacing spark plugs or ignition coils. You may also experience dead scan-tool communication, where your diagnostic equipment cannot establish a link with the module at all. Because the PCM oversees transmission operation in addition to engine management, rough or erratic shifting can also point to a computer issue rather than a mechanical transmission failure. Surging idle, poor fuel economy, and a check engine light that returns immediately after clearing are additional red flags. If your Tundra exhibits several of these symptoms simultaneously and conventional repairs have not resolved them, the engine computer itself becomes a strong candidate for further testing.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"info-section\">\n<h2>Factory Service Bulletins Worth Knowing<\/h2>\n<p>Toyota issued service bulletin TC002-03, titled &#8220;ECM Reset Memory Function,&#8221; which applies to all 2000-2005 Toyota vehicles including your 2000 Tundra, as well as 2004-2005 Scion models. This bulletin was revised at some point and addresses the procedure for resetting the engine control module&#8217;s memory function. The reset process clears learned adaptive values stored in the ECM, returning the fuel trim and idle adaptations to their factory baseline. This can be useful after repairs to the intake, fuel, or ignition systems, or when a module has been replaced and needs to relearn operating parameters. If your technician is performing work on the engine computer, referencing this bulletin ensures the reset procedure follows Toyota&#8217;s documented method.
